I am using CRXI against a Postgres database.
In my report, I have a crosstab with several groups. Is there a way to show each group on every row?
Code:
Right now my output looks like this:
Country  Province  City
                   City
         Province  City
                   City

And the requirement is this:
Country  Province  City
Country  Province  City
Country  Province  City
Country  Province  City

Is there a way to do this?

I had to write a crosstab like this with Customer names, but when i grouped in the crosstab, all 15 "Jones Grocery" grouped together. I simply wrote a little formula that concatenated the fields into one. It was easy with not a lot of fuss.

Good luck.
 
Yes, you can either concatenate the fields and use the result as your only row, or you could reorder the rows:

city->province->country
